DESCRIPTION:James Pugh\nSearching for targets in an unknown environment is
  a task well-suited for mobile robots\, and especially for a distributed g
 roup of robots working in collaboration.  In this work\, a suite of new to
 ols and methods for distributed robotic search are presented: an on-board 
 robotic module that allows multiple searching robots to determine their re
 lative locations\; a learning-based technique to automatically evolve robo
 tic search controllers\; and a set of models that can predict how robots w
 ill behave in the search process.  These tools and methods are tested in e
 xperiments with up to 10 real mobile robots.
